Best time to visit
Early morning visits offer calm seas and fewer crowds, while the dry season from May to October provides the clearest waters for snorkeling and diving.
Budget tips
Ferries often have combo deals with snorkeling gear rentals; booking online in advance saves money. Look for afternoon ferry discounts and bring your own snorkel gear to avoid rental fees.

About
Quick facts: The island boasts one of the largest coral reef ecosystems right off its shores, teeming with colorful marine life. It sits just 6.9 kilometers from the mainland, making it an accessible yet tropical escape.
Highlights: A stunning underwater scooter tour allows visitors to glide through vibrant coral gardens, encountering turtles, reef sharks, and schools of fish up close. At night, the island transforms as bioluminescent plankton light up the waters, creating a magical glowing shoreline.
Insider tips
- Wear reef-safe sunscreen to protect marine life and yourself.
- Capture amazing underwater shots at the coral bommie near the western beach.
- Avoid weekends to enjoy quieter beaches and trails.
- Pack a light rain jacket during the early dry season as showers can be brief but sudden.
